Engine Performance and Riding Characteristics Powered by a 0.53 HP (0.4 kW) electric engine, the Clipic Off Tank Electric delivers a top speed of 30 km/h (18.6 mph), perfect for city commutes and quick trips around town. The electric powertrain offers smooth acceleration and a quiet ride, allowing you to glide through the streets with ease. Weighing in at only 82 kg (180.8 pounds), the Off Tank Electric boasts an impressive power-to-weight ratio of 0.0065 HP/kg, ensuring nimble handling and agility in urban environments. The hydraulic front fork and double shock absorber rear suspension work in harmony to absorb bumps and provide a comfortable ride, allowing you to navigate potholes and uneven surfaces without a hitch. Key Features and Technology The Clipic Off Tank Electric is packed with features that enhance the riding experience. Its electric starter ensures a hassle-free ignition process, while the scooter's advanced battery configuration—four 20AH 12V batteries—provides an impressive range of up to 32 km on a single charge. Recharging is straightforward, taking approximately 6 hours to restore full power, making it easy to plug in overnight or during the day while at work. The scooter is equipped with reliable single disc brakes at both the front and rear, each with a diameter of 160 mm (6.3 inches), ensuring effective stopping power when you need it most. Additionally, with a seat height of 630 mm (24.8 inches), it's designed for accessibility, making it suitable for a wide range of riders. **
Pros
Cons
- Eco-Friendly: Zero emissions and low energy consumption make it an excellent choice for environmentally conscious riders.
- Lightweight and Agile: At just 82 kg, it offers excellent maneuverability in urban environments, perfect for navigating through traffic.
- User-Friendly: Easy electric start and simple charging process make it accessible to riders of all experience levels.
- Limited Range: With a maximum range of 32 km, it may not be suitable for longer commutes without frequent charging.
- Low Power Output: At 0.53 HP, it may struggle with steep inclines or carrying extra weight compared to traditional gas-powered scooters.
- Top Speed Limitations: With a maximum speed of 30 km/h, it may not keep up with faster traffic, which could be a concern in busy urban settings.
